CybercultureAuthor(s): Pierre Levy\nFormat: Paperback\nPublisher: University of Minnesota Press, United States\nImprint: University of Minnesota Press\nISBN-13: 9780816636105, 978-0816636105\nSynopsis\nA clear explanation and provocative look at the impact of new technologies on world society.\n\nNeeding guidance and seeking insight, the Council of Europe approached Pierre Lvy, one of the worlds most important and well-respected theorists of digital culture, for a report on the state (and, frankly, the nature) of cyberspace. The result is this extraordinary document, a perfectly lucid and accessible description of cyberspace-from infrastructure to practical applications-along with an inspired, far-reaching exploration of its ramifications.
